Output 6ad58b945f42926206f79608f052b18c5a1dddc15a93359644c2e84426a09d5e:2

value
309081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b966d8d903d755796cd66e96708f5f21d649f38 OP_EQUAL
address
3CxVF4AwBbdciMbQPBLid9sF51J8NxqBwt
transaction
6ad58b945f42926206f79608f052b18c5a1dddc15a93359644c2e84426a09d5e